[dropcap class=”kp-dropcap”]A[/dropcap]rguably one of the best modern cannabis-friendly TV shows was Workaholics. There’s no doubt in our minds that the sheer comedic genius behind the story of three college dropouts (played by Adam Devine, Anders Holm and Blake Anderson) who are stuck in a dead-end telemarketing job is just a gem of entertainment. But Workaholics wasn’t meant to last forever, and like many great shows before them, it ended its run last year in March 2017.

Today, those three young dropouts are, sort of, returning. Well, the party-loving, cannabis-embracing trio are returning for a Netflix film release called Game Over, Man! which we think is right down our alley.
